Eunice experiences intense summer monsoons due to its arid desert climate, leading to rapid water accumulation on hard-packed dirt and gravel surfaces. The lack of natural drainage exacerbates flooding in low-lying areas and residential neighborhoods.

Local mold risk: Mold can begin to grow within 24 hours after flooding in Eunice homes, especially in stucco and concrete structures that retain moisture. Prompt water extraction and drying are critical to prevent long-term mold damage and health risks.
